diff options
author | Dmytro Dubovyk <dmytro.dubovyk@ti.com> | 2012-12-18 18:07:50 +0200 |
---|---|---|
committer | Sergii Iegorov <x0155539@ti.com> | 2012-12-19 11:14:38 +0200 |
commit | 729f6685f9dfb7a1813a89dbf2298024d9da3813 (patch) | |
tree | aea36c6ab06c38e7e841dcad0713f8c1c2de06fb | |
parent | 7979b58a7ade37c3b6d574fd647e633c5b57c3f1 (diff) | |
download | frameworks_base-729f6685f9dfb7a1813a89dbf2298024d9da3813.zip frameworks_base-729f6685f9dfb7a1813a89dbf2298024d9da3813.tar.gz frameworks_base-729f6685f9dfb7a1813a89dbf2298024d9da3813.tar.bz2 |
Setting the default value for dock audio
There was no default value for parameter "dock_audio_media_enabled"
in global settings and because of that it couldn't be obtained before
Settings app first start and improper actions, such as FORCE_NONE
sending to AudioSystem instead of FORCE_ANALOG_DOCK, were taken.
This patch sets default value to 'true'.
Change-Id: Idbe343519db15f806f3a237e8b39f8420b9edde1
Signed-off-by: Dmytro Dubovyk <dmytro.dubovyk@ti.com>
-rw-r--r-- | packages/SettingsProvider/res/values/defaults.xml | 1 | ||||
-rw-r--r-- | packages/SettingsProvider/src/com/android/providers/settings/DatabaseHelper.java | 3 |
2 files changed, 4 insertions, 0 deletions
diff --git a/packages/SettingsProvider/res/values/defaults.xml b/packages/SettingsProvider/res/values/defaults.xml index 94e2286..52df8d0 100644 --- a/packages/SettingsProvider/res/values/defaults.xml +++ b/packages/SettingsProvider/res/values/defaults.xml @@ -77,6 +77,7 @@ <string name="def_unlock_sound" translatable="false">/system/media/audio/ui/Unlock.ogg</string> <bool name="def_lockscreen_disabled">false</bool> <bool name="def_device_provisioned">false</bool> + <integer name="def_dock_audio_media_enabled">1</integer> <!-- Notifications use ringer volume --> <bool name="def_notifications_use_ring_volume">true</bool> diff --git a/packages/SettingsProvider/src/com/android/providers/settings/DatabaseHelper.java b/packages/SettingsProvider/src/com/android/providers/settings/DatabaseHelper.java index b649b43..7864ec2 100644 --- a/packages/SettingsProvider/src/com/android/providers/settings/DatabaseHelper.java +++ b/packages/SettingsProvider/src/com/android/providers/settings/DatabaseHelper.java @@ -2181,6 +2181,9 @@ public class DatabaseHelper extends SQLiteOpenHelper { loadStringSetting(stmt, Settings.Global.CAR_UNDOCK_SOUND, R.string.def_car_undock_sound); + loadIntegerSetting(stmt, Settings.Global.DOCK_AUDIO_MEDIA_ENABLED, + R.integer.def_dock_audio_media_enabled); + loadSetting(stmt, Settings.Global.SET_INSTALL_LOCATION, 0); loadSetting(stmt, Settings.Global.DEFAULT_INSTALL_LOCATION, PackageHelper.APP_INSTALL_AUTO); |